Choosing the right home service platform in BC comes down to five key criteria. Here's how to evaluate each one.

BC's home service market has expanded rapidly in recent years, with dozens of platforms and apps promising to connect homeowners with cleaning, handyman, moving, and junk removal professionals. The difference in quality, accountability, and consumer protection between platforms is significant. This guide gives you a clear framework for evaluating any home service platform operating in Metro Vancouver.

1. Provider Vetting Standards

For services that involve access to your home — cleaning, handyman, locksmith — you want a platform that conducts full vetting. Ask explicitly: "Do your providers have criminal record checks and carry liability insurance?" A platform that can't answer this clearly is telling you something.

2. Insurance Coverage and Accountability

Platforms that shift all liability entirely to the homeowner — where the platform is only a "connector" — provide meaningfully less protection than platforms that maintain accountability standards for their providers.

3. Transparent and Upfront Pricing

Any platform where you don't know the price until the provider arrives and assesses on-site creates conditions for the escalating-quote problem — where initial low prices expand once work has started.

5. Local Service and Service Area Depth

National platforms often have uneven coverage — they may perform well in Vancouver proper but have thin provider networks in Coquitlam, Delta, or Pitt Meadows. A Metro Vancouver-focused platform with deep local provider networks offers better service consistency across the region. Ask specifically whether they have providers in your municipality, not just "Metro Vancouver."

Frequently Asked Questions

What should I look for in a home service platform in BC?
Provider vetting standards (criminal record checks, insurance verification), accountability and damage claims process, transparent upfront pricing, review integrity (verified bookings only), and genuine local coverage in your specific Metro Vancouver area.
Are home service platforms in BC regulated?
Not specifically. Individual trades are regulated under BC trades certification, but platforms themselves are not — which is why vetting standards vary so significantly.
Why do some home service platforms have such low prices?
Very low prices typically mean uninsured providers, no background checks, inconsistent quality, or introductory pricing that increases on repeat bookings. The all-in cost of cheap-then-damaged is usually higher than paying market rate for quality from the start.
What is the difference between a home service platform and a staffing agency?
A platform connects customers with independent contractors; a staffing agency places employees. The key question for you is accountability: who is responsible if something goes wrong?
How do I verify a platform's providers are actually insured?
Ask the platform directly and request documentation for your booking. For higher-value work, ask the provider for a certificate of insurance before work begins.
